Dhaka, the vibrant capital of Bangladesh, is not only known for its bustling streets and rich culture but also for its diverse food market. One of the most appealing aspects for residents and visitors alike is the availability of discounted fresh foods. With a growing awareness of healthy eating and budget-friendly shopping, many local markets and supermarkets in Dhaka offer a variety of fresh produce at reduced prices.
Fresh fruits and vegetables are at the forefront of these discounts. Markets such as Karwan Bazar and New Market are popular spots where shoppers can find seasonal fruits like mangoes, bananas, and guavas at lower prices. Local farmers often bring their produce directly to the markets, which helps keep costs down and ensures the freshness of the items.
Moreover, during specific seasons or festivals, many vendors offer special promotions on bulk purchases. This is an excellent opportunity for families to stock up on essential ingredients without breaking the bank. Additionally, supermarkets like Shwapno and Meena Bazar frequently have sales on fresh foods, making it easier for city dwellers to access quality products at affordable rates.
Shopping for discounted fresh foods not only supports local farmers and vendors but also encourages a healthier lifestyle.
